#af5799 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#af5799 is composed of 68.6% red, 34.1% green and 60%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 50.3% magenta, 12.6% yellow and 31.4% black. It has a hue angle of 315 degrees, a saturation of 35.5% and a lightness of 51.4%. #af5799 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ffaeff with #5f0033. Closest websafe color is: #996699.

#af5799 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#af5799 has RGB values of R:175, G:87, B:153 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.5, Y:0.13, K:0.31. Its decimal value is 11491225.

Hex triplet af5799 #af5799
RGB Decimal 175, 87, 153 rgb(175,87,153)
RGB Percent 68.6, 34.1, 60 rgb(68.6%,34.1%,60%)
CMYK 0, 50, 13, 31
HSL 315°, 35.5, 51.4 hsl(315,35.5%,51.4%)
HSV (or HSB) 315°, 50.3, 68.6
Web Safe 996699 #996699
CIE-LAB 49.776, 44.503, -19.898
XYZ 26.837, 18.232, 32.241
xyY 0.347, 0.236, 18.232
CIE-LCH 49.776, 48.749, 335.91
CIE-LUV 49.776, 46.935, -35.628
Hunter-Lab 42.699, 37.467, -14.879
Binary 10101111, 01010111, 10011001

Shades and Tints of #af5799

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050204 is the darkest color, while #fbf6fa is the lightest one.
